Battle Royale
"Battle Royale" traditionally refers to a fight not limited to two combatants, but since the release of the dystopian novel and film of the same name, it's come to refer to a genre of fiction in which a large group of people participate in a free-for-all fight, often to the death. The surging popularity of media like The Hunger Games, Squid Game, and Fortnite has led to a number of tabletop roleplaying games inspired by the battle royale genre, some of which have players work as a team, and others which pit them against each other in a brutal, no-holds-barred deathmatch!
